By the time the first acts land of snow scene draws to a close, the stage is a true winter wonderland, complete with reigning snow king, queen and prince, an ensemble of female snowflakes, male snow winds, a chorus of tiny snow tree angels holding flickering candles, and a theatrical snowfall so dense it might well keep planes at ohare grounded for hours. Dec 14, 2012 robert joffrey changed the traditional european setting to a 19th century american home, peppering the stahlbaum family christmas tree with toys from his own childhood. Joffrey stuck close to the original ballet from 1892 but gave it more of an american feel, placing act one in a 19th century american home with pieces of his own childhood influencing the set.
